Subject: Key rotation — Spokeshift rebalancer

Hi,

We rotated the credentials for the Spokeshift rebalancing tool's connection to the internal Dockmap service this morning. The old key stops working Friday at noon. Please update the release config before then and redeploy the scheduler. No other settings changed. The new key is below.

Thanks,
Platform team

gateway credential: kto3_qfe

# Break-Glass Access: Shrinkbatch CLI

Shrinkbatch handles batch image resizing for the Pellwood asset pipeline. Normal deploys go through Corvid CI. Break-glass is for pipeline-down emergencies only: it grants direct write access to the resize queue, bypassing review. Use sparingly; every invocation pages the platform lead and is logged to the audit bucket. Reviewers: reject any PR that adds break-glass calls to routine scripts. To activate, run `shrinkbatch breakglass` and supply the recovery passphrase, which is:

unlock words, hahip-baduf: holwyn-istath-julvan

Subject: Basement archive room

New starters: the archive room is in the basement of Harrow Court, past the plant room. Take the service stairs, not the lift. Lights are on a timer; the switch is inside the door. Return all files by end of day and sign the ledger. The keypad code for the archive door follows below.

staff pass of kawip-hawef = bdg-QLP-2